This patch the I2C board information for the WM8994 used in the Aquila
as audio codec and adds the I2C/I2S platform drivers. Additionlly, to
control power consumption have registerd the voltage consumer of WM8994
to the regulator framework. I initialize gpio settting relevant to
operation of audio codec. I explain following comment concering gpio
setting:
- CODEC_XTAL_EN : This gpio enables that the main clock is provided
  to operate audio codec.
- MICBIAS_EN : This gpio enable the microphone to input analog
- ADC_EN : This gpio enable the ADC device which is used to detect
  the kind of jack. (SND_JACK_HEADPHONE/HEADSET/MECHANICAL/AVOUT)
  According to the kind of jack, an electric current is changed.

+static void __init aquila_sound_init(void)
+{
+       unsigned int gpio;
+
+       /* CODEC_XTAL_EN */
+       gpio = S5PV210_GPH3(2);         /* XEINT_26 */
+       gpio_request(gpio, "CODEC_XTAL_EN");
+       s3c_gpio_cfgpin(gpio, S3C_GPIO_OUTPUT);
+       s3c_gpio_setpull(gpio, S3C_GPIO_PULL_NONE);
+       gpio_direction_output(gpio, 1);
+
+       /* CLKOUT[9:8] set to 0x3(XUSBXTI) of 0xE010E000(OTHERS)
+        * for 24MHZ
+        */
+       writel(readl(S5P_OTHERS) | (0x3 << 8), S5P_OTHERS);
+
+       /* MICBIAS_EN */
+       gpio = S5PV210_GPJ4(2);                 /* XMSMRN */
+       gpio_request(gpio, "MICBIAS_EN");
+       s3c_gpio_cfgpin(gpio, S3C_GPIO_OUTPUT);
+       gpio_direction_output(gpio, 1);
+
+       /* ADC_EN */
+       gpio = S5PV210_GPJ3(2);
+       gpio_request(gpio, "ADC_EN");
+       s3c_gpio_cfgpin(gpio, S3C_GPIO_OUTPUT);
+       gpio_direction_output(gpio, 1);
+}
